So, I’m trying to switch from CGCalendar to Khronos and if I import CGCalendar data it shows up in the backend but if I load the front end calendar view, an alert comes up saying “Oops... something happened when we were talking to the server, please try again”. The browser’s error console tells me that there is an error 500 loading http://localhost/index.php?mact=Khronos,cntnt01,ajax_fetchevents,0&cntnt01detailpage=16&cntnt01returnid=16&cntnt01showchildren=1&cntnt01detailpage=16&cntnt01eventtemplate=&cntnt01editpage=&cntnt01editeventtemplate=&start=2024-04-01&end=2024-05-13&_=1712871139977

Also, all past events are there in the backend but if I’m adding a new one, this error comes up:
FATAL ERROR:
QUERY = INSERT INTO cms_module_khronos_events (event_id, event_title, event_summary, event_details, event_date_start, event_date_end, event_parent_id, event_recur_period, event_date_recur_end, event_created_by, event_recur_nevents, event_recur_interval, event_recur_weekdays, event_recur_monthdays, event_allows_overlap,event_all_day,event_status, event_create_date, event_modified_date) VALUES (59,'Test','','','2024-04-18 12:00:00',NULL,-1,'none',NULL,-101,-1,-1,'','',1,0,'D',NOW(),NOW())
ERROR = Unknown column 'event_status' in 'field list'
So, apparently something goes wrong with the import from CGCalendar.
